diff options
| -rw-r--r-- | lib/sqlalchemy/orm/strategies.py | 2 | ||||
| -rw-r--r-- | test/testlib/testing.py | 4 |
2 files changed, 4 insertions, 2 deletions
diff --git a/lib/sqlalchemy/orm/strategies.py b/lib/sqlalchemy/orm/strategies.py index e59114577..4028eed6a 100644 --- a/lib/sqlalchemy/orm/strategies.py +++ b/lib/sqlalchemy/orm/strategies.py @@ -594,7 +594,7 @@ class EagerLoader(AbstractRelationLoader): def create_row_processor(self, selectcontext, mapper, row): row_decorator = self._create_row_decorator(selectcontext, row, selectcontext.path) - pathstr = ','.join(str(x) for x in selectcontext.path) + pathstr = ','.join([str(x) for x in selectcontext.path]) if row_decorator is not None: def execute(instance, row, isnew, **flags): decorated_row = row_decorator(row) diff --git a/test/testlib/testing.py b/test/testlib/testing.py index 69b5d8fed..cf0936e92 100644 --- a/test/testlib/testing.py +++ b/test/testlib/testing.py @@ -418,7 +418,9 @@ class ExecutionContextWrapper(object): ) \ and \ ( (params is None) or (params == parameters) - or params == [dict((k.strip('_'), v) for (k, v) in p.items())for p in parameters] + or params == [dict([(k.strip('_'), v) + for (k, v) in p.items()]) + for p in parameters] ) testdata.unittest.assert_(equivalent, "Testing for query '%s' params %s, received '%s' with params %s" % (query, repr(params), statement, repr(parameters))) |
